How much do senior system administrator j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ior system administrator in Basking Ridge, NJ is $105,353.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$88,600.00 and $120,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ges a senior system administrator may encounter when managing hybrid cloud environments?

Senior System Administrators often face challenges balancing on-premises infrastructure with cloud-based resources, which can include ensuring consistent security policies, managing data synchronization, and monitoring system performance across multiple platforms. They must also stay updated on evolving technologies and compliance requirements, as well as collaborate closely with development, security, and networking teams. Addressing these complexities requires strong problem-solving skills, robust documentation practices, and a proactive approach to both troubleshooting and automation.

What does a senior system administrator do?

A Senior System Administrator is responsible for managing, maintaining, and securing an organization's IT infrastructure, including servers, networks, and related systems. They oversee the installation and configuration of hardware and software, troubleshoot complex technical issues, and ensure the reliability and performance of IT services. Senior System Administrators also implement security policies, perform regular system updates, and may supervise junior IT staff. Their expertise is essential for minimizing system downtime and protecting data integrity.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ior system administrator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ior System Administrator, you need in-depth knowledge of operating systems, networking, security protocols, and significant experience managing IT infrastructure, usually backed by a degree in computer science or related certifications (such as CompTIA, Microsoft, or Cisco). Expertise with tools like VMware, Active Directory, PowerShell, and cloud platforms (AWS, Azure) is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ication are crucial soft skills for this role. These abilities ensure reliable system performance, minimize downtime, and support the technology needs of an organization.

What is the difference between Senior System Administrator vs Network Administrator?

AspectSenior System AdministratorNetwork Administrator
CertificationsCompTIA Server+, Microsoft Certified: Windows Server, Cisco CCNACompTIA Network+, Cisco CCNA, Cisco CCNP
Work EnvironmentData centers, enterprise IT environments, server managementNetwork infrastructure, routing, switching, network security
ResponsibilitiesServer deployment, maintenance, troubleshooting, system upgradesNetwork setup, monitoring, troubleshooting, security management

While both roles require networking and system knowledge, Senior System Administrators focus on server and system management, whereas Network Administrators specialize in network infrastructure. Both roles are essential in enterprise IT, often collaborating to ensure seamless technology operations.
